Using ruler and a pair compass only, construct a triangle PQR, given PQ = 5.5 cm, QR = 7.5 cm and RP = 6 cm. Draw the bisectors of the interior angles at P, Q and R. Do these bisectors meet at the same point ?

Steps of Construction :

(1) Draw a line PQ = 5.5 cm.

(2) From Q as a center draw an arc QR = 7.5 cm.

(3) From P as a center draw an arc PR = 6 m, which intersects the previous arc at R.

(4) Join PR and QR.

(5) Now, draw interior bisectors of ∠P, ∠QR ∠R which meets each other at point S.
